Distance From Rangiroa Airport to Tikehau Atoll Airport (RGI - TIH Distance)

The flight distance from Rangiroa Airport (RGI) to Tikehau Atoll Airport (TIH) is 40 miles. This is equivalent to 64 kilometers or 35 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.


64 kilometers is the distance from Rangiroa Airport, French Polynesia to Tikehau Atoll Airport, French Polynesia.
